Heim >Web-Frontend >CSS-Tutorial >Wie kann ich zusätzliche Leerzeichen über meinen HTML-Headern entfernen?

Wie kann ich zusätzliche Leerzeichen über meinen HTML-Headern entfernen?

DDD
DDDOriginal
2024-12-04 10:00:21615Durchsuche

How Can I Remove Extra Whitespace Above My HTML Headers?

Randraum um HTML-Header auflösen

Das Entfernen des Leerraums über einem HTML-Header erfordert die Beseitigung des zugrunde liegenden Grunds für sein Auftreten, der sogenannten Margin Collapsed . In CSS führt die Randreduzierung benachbarte Ränder zusammen, was zu zusätzlichem Platz führt.

Um diesen unerwünschten Platz zu beseitigen, ist die CSS-Eigenschaft margin-top: 0; kann auf das h1-Element im Header angewendet werden. Dadurch wird der obere Rand der Kopfzeile auf Null gesetzt und der Leerraum effektiv entfernt.

CSS-Code für die Randanpassung:

Für den in der Frage bereitgestellten HTML- und CSS-Code Durch Hinzufügen des folgenden CSS wird das Problem behoben:

h1 {
  margin-top: 0;
}

Durch die Anwendung dieses CSS wird der obere Rand des h1-Elements im Header auf Null gesetzt. Überschreiben Sie den übernommenen Rand und entfernen Sie den zusätzlichen Platz über der Kopfzeile.

Das obige ist der detaillierte Inhalt vonWie kann ich zusätzliche Leerzeichen über meinen HTML-Headern entfernen?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n